We are selling a 1973 Mercedes 450SL Roadster with 102,500 original miles. It has a 5.4 L double overhead cam aluminum motor which runs strong. I have been in the process od trying to restore this hard to find "classic" Mercedes which has the European bumpers and no smog control system. I have had new floor pans and firewalls welded in to eleminate some rust. On top of this we added the :hush" mat which is insulation topped with aluminum for quiteness and heat control. The car was gone over by certified mercedes mechanic's and the following was installed: Complete new exaust system, fule pump and hoses, two drive differentials, rear brake calipers and break lines, all fluids changed, tune up and fule injecters inspected, new carpet thruout as well as trunk carpet kit. New seat form, cobers, backs, door panels and dash. The car does smoke a little on startup and probably needs a valve job. Air condition needs one hose replaced for good a/c. I have also put on four brand new tires as well as new headrests. Windshield has no chips or cracks and left mirrow glass needs replacing. Not the mirrow total just the reflectice mirrow glass piece. I am now retired and donot have the money to finish the restoration. The car also comes with a car cover and a new hoist kit for the hard top. It has a few rust spots on the body which can be restored at the body shop before painting.
I paid $5k for the car and I have put another $10k into this car. It is a great deal for someone wanting to take advantage of having most of the restoration done at no cost to them. Mercedes A-Class next up for facelift
Sun, Jan 11 2015This is the coming Mercedes-Benz A-Class, and in case the paucity of camouflage didn't make it clear, it won't look much different the one that's been on sale for all of two years. Caught in Sweden braving the temperatures, its exterior updates aren't expected to go much further than a reworked face that brings it in line with the recently updated B-Class, including a new grille, headlights and taillights, and bumpers. The cabin is where most of the work is being done, to give it a better punch against the BMW 1 Series. A tweaked dash cluster, better fabrics and materials, the eight-inch tablet-style nav/multimedia screen, and ambient lighting should join the party. The updated range of B-Class engines should also make the jump into the A. A photo caught at a dealer meeting in Barcelona last year makes us pretty sure it will be introduced at the Frankfurt Motor Show in September this year. Until then, there are spy shots to peruse.
Mercedes Sprinter updated to take on Ford Transit, Ram ProMaster
Mon, 29 Apr 2013By the end of this year, the Mercedes-Benz Sprinter will be the second-oldest nameplate in its segment here in the States, but with hot new competition waiting in the wings, Mercedes-Benz is giving its hauler a freshened look and more equipment to stave off rivals. The Sprinter was a pioneer in bringing Euro-style delivery vans to North America, and it's inspired others to transplant their Continental offerings, with the all-new Ford Transit and Ram Promaster models launching shortly. It will also continue to do battle with lower-cost traditional competitors like the Chevrolet Express and Ford E-Series.
The big Sprinter will thus get a new look to go with more safety features and available technology. While the information released here technically covers the Euro-spec 2013 Sprinter (which goes on sale in September), the US market is expected to get the new Sprinter for the 2014 model year with many of the same features. Some of this new technology includes a Crosswind Assist feature as standard equipment and the availability of Collision Prevention Assist and Blind Spot Assist as optional safety measures - Mercedes-Benz says that all three are firsts for any van in the world. Also added to the updated Sprinter is a new 1.8-liter supercharged gasoline (or CNG) engine producing 156 horsepower, which will complement the line of diesel engines that carry over and help make the Sprinter the first cargo van to meet the upcoming Euro VI emissions standards. Additionally, a lower ride height is said to improve fuel economy and should improve handling while aiding ingress and egress for both people and cargo.
In terms of styling, the Sprinter's new face also looks more like the current line of Mercedes-Benz passenger cars. This includes a more upright grille along with changes to the hood, headlights and bumper that lend it a closer kinship to models like the CLS-Class and the updated E-Class. The Sprinter will offer both halogen and HID headlights, while the latter will get LED running lamps and offer Highbeam Assist. The images shown here only reveal the exterior from front angles, but it looks like few, if any, changes have been made to the rear of the van. Interior upgrades include a thicker steering wheel, a new shift lever and the latest in audio, navigation and entertainment systems. Which electric cars can charge at a Tesla Supercharger?
Sun, Jul 9 2023The difference between Tesla charging and non-Tesla charging. Electrify America; Tesla Tesla's advantage has long been its charging technology and Supercharger network. Now, more and more automakers are switching to Tesla's charging tech. But there are a few things non-Tesla drivers need to know about charging at a Tesla station. A lot has hit the news cycle in recent months with regard to electric car drivers and where they can and can't plug in. The key factor in all of that? Whether automakers switched to Tesla's charging standard. More car companies are shifting to Tesla's charging tech in the hopes of boosting their customers' confidence in going electric. Here's what it boils down to: If you currently drive a Tesla, you can keep charging at Tesla charging locations, which use the company's North American Charging Standard (NACS), which has long served it well. The chargers are thinner, more lightweight and easier to wrangle than other brands. If you currently drive a non-Tesla EV, you have to charge at a non-Tesla charging station like that of Electrify America or EVgo — which use the Combined Charging System (CCS) — unless you stumble upon a Tesla charger already equipped with the Magic Dock adapter. For years, CCS tech dominated EVs from everyone but Tesla. Starting next year, if you drive a non-Tesla EV (from the automakers that have announced they'll make the switch), you'll be able to charge at all Supercharger locations with an adapter. And by 2025, EVs from some automakers won't even need an adaptor. Here's how to charge up, depending on which EV you have: Ford 2021 Ford Mustang Mach-E. Tim Levin/Insider Ford was the earliest traditional automaker to team up with Tesla for its charging tech. Current Ford EV owners — those driving a Ford electric vehicle already fitted with a CCS port — will be able to use a Tesla-developed adapter to access Tesla Superchargers starting in the spring. That means that, if you own a Mustang Mach-E or Ford F-150 Lightning, you will need the adapter in order to use a Tesla station come 2024. But Ford will equip its future EVs with the NACS port starting in 2025 — eliminating the need for any adapter. Owners of new Ford EVs will be able to pull into a Supercharger station and juice up, no problem. General Motors Cadillac Lyriq. Cadillac GM will also allow its EV drivers to plug into Tesla stations.
